Ensalada Caribena Recipe
JÍcama, red pepper, mango and papaya, tossed with our house-made glaze. Served on a bed of mixed greens.

Method
Salad Preparation
- 1
Prepare the Mixed Greens
Wash and dry the mixed greens thoroughly. Place them in a large salad bowl as the base of the salad.
- 2
Cut the Jícama
Peel the jícama and cut it into thin matchsticks or cubes. Add to the bowl with the mixed greens.
- 3
Chop the Red Bell Pepper
Remove the seeds and stem from the red bell pepper, then chop it into small pieces. Add to the salad bowl.
- 4
Prepare the Mango
Peel the mango, remove the pit, and slice it into thin pieces or cubes. Add to the salad bowl.
- 5
Cut the Papaya
Peel the papaya, remove the seeds, and cut it into small cubes. Add to the salad bowl.
Glaze Preparation
- 6
Mix the Glaze Ingredients
In a small bowl, whisk together the honey, lime juice, olive oil, salt, and black pepper until well combined.
- 7
Dress the Salad
Drizzle the house-made glaze over the salad ingredients in the bowl.
- 8
Toss the Salad
Gently toss the salad to ensure all ingredients are evenly coated with the glaze.
